Fiona

Fiona has been News Editor for CAT and MS&T Magazines since 2001. She regularly writes and posts news to the website and writes and edits the news digest for the magazines. Additionally, Fiona has written a number of cabin crew features for CAT. Fiona also works on the production side of the magazines, editing and administering the editorial content for all publications. Fiona is Conference Co-ordinator for WATS, EATS and APATS, managing all speaker logistics.

VT MAK has announced the release of VR-Link 5.4. Used for HLA & DIS Simulation Networking, VR-Link provides an easy way to network simulators and other virtual reality applications using industry standard protocols.
